  1. Let’s get knotty: (The mooring hitch) By: Katherine Seaman and Devan Smith

  2. What is the mooring hitch used for? The mooring hitch is used to tie boats to docks, or poles. The mooring hitch can also be used to secure a line to a boat.

  4. Step 1 First, droop the line over your left hand, with your palm up.

  5. Step 2 Pinch the two ends together to make a medium-sized loop.

  6. Step 3 Take the right line and cross it over the left .

  7. Step 4 Twist the lines once more so that you have twisted the line twice.

  8. Step 5 Fold the loop over the twisted portion.

  9. Step 6 Your knot should now look like an 8 in a circle.

  10. Step 7 Pinch the center of the 8.

  11. Step 8 Pull the center of the 8 upward.

  12. Step 9 You now have your mooring hitch!
